Step Into History: Walking Through Old Town Stockholm

The journey begins in Gamla Stan, Stockholm’s historic heart and one of the best-preserved medieval city centers in Europe. Dating back to the 13th century, this enchanting district offers a glimpse into life as it was in the 16th century. As you walk along its narrow, winding alleys, you will notice colorful buildings leaning slightly toward each other, creating a cozy and intimate atmosphere.

Every corner of Old Town Stockholm tells a story. From hidden courtyards to centuries-old shops, the area is filled with character and charm. The cobblestone streets echo with history, inviting visitors to slow down and truly absorb the surroundings. Whether you are a history enthusiast or a casual traveler, Gamla Stan offers an immersive experience that feels both authentic and magical.

Marvel at the Majestic Royal Castle

One of the highlights of your walking tour is the magnificent Royal Castle (Kungliga Slottet). Standing proudly in the heart of the Old Town, this grand structure is one of the largest palaces in Europe still in use today. With over 600 rooms, it serves as both the official residence of the Swedish monarch and a symbol of the country’s rich heritage.

Visitors can explore several museums within the castle, each offering unique insights into royal history. The changing of the guard ceremony is another must-see experience, adding a sense of tradition and pageantry to your visit. The castle’s architecture, with its impressive facade and elegant interiors, reflects the grandeur of Sweden’s royal past.

Discover Hidden Gems and Cultural Treasures

Beyond the major landmarks, Gamla Stan is filled with hidden gems waiting to be discovered. Explore charming cafes, artisan boutiques, and historic squares such as Stortorget, the oldest square in Stockholm. Known for its vibrant buildings and fascinating history, this square is a perfect spot to pause and take in the atmosphere.

As you wander deeper into the Old Town, you will encounter medieval churches, narrow passages, and stories etched into the walls of ancient buildings. The blend of history, culture, and everyday life creates a unique experience that is both enriching and memorable.

Explore Gothenburgs Haga A Walking Tour Through Time and Charm

After experiencing the historic elegance of Old Town Stockholm and its scenic waterways, the journey continues in Gothenburg with a walk through the enchanting district of Haga. Known for its preserved heritage and timeless appeal, Haga offers a completely different yet equally captivating glimpse into Sweden’s past. This charming neighborhood invites visitors to slow down and step into a world where the 19th century atmosphere still lingers in every street and building.

As you begin your walking tour, the first thing that captures attention is the row of beautiful wooden houses lining the cobbled streets. Painted in warm, earthy tones, these traditional homes reflect a simpler time when craftsmanship and community defined everyday life. Unlike the grand royal architecture of Stockholm, Haga presents a more intimate and human scale experience, making it feel welcoming and authentic.

Walking through Haga Nygata, the main street of the district, you will notice a perfect blend of history and modern charm. Small boutiques, artisan shops, and cozy cafes are tucked within centuries-old buildings, creating a unique atmosphere where past and present coexist beautifully. The pace here is relaxed, allowing visitors to truly absorb the surroundings, much like wandering through Gamla Stan but with a quieter, more local feel.

The history of Haga is both fascinating and deeply rooted in Gothenburg’s development. Once considered a working-class suburb in the 17th century, it evolved over time into a cultural and historical gem. A professional guide brings this transformation to life through insider stories and local folklore, sharing tales of resilience, community spirit, and the people who shaped the area. These narratives add depth to the experience, making every street feel alive with memory.

Tivoli Gardens Entry Ticket with Unlimited Rides A Magical Copenhagen Experience

After walking through the cultural streets of Copenhagen with a local guide and discovering the historic elegance of Old Town Stockholm (Gamla Stan) and Gothenburgs Haga, it is time to experience a different side of Scandinavian travel one filled with excitement, lights, and timeless charm. Tivoli Gardens, one of the worlds oldest amusement parks, offers a perfect blend of entertainment, nostalgia, and beauty right in the heart of Copenhagen.

With an entry ticket that includes unlimited rides, visitors can fully immerse themselves in the vibrant atmosphere of this iconic attraction. From thrilling roller coasters to gentle family rides, Tivoli caters to every kind of traveler. The park’s design reflects a magical fusion of classic European gardens and lively entertainment, creating an environment that feels both elegant and playful.

Adventure seekers will enjoy the excitement of rides like the Milky Way Express roller coaster, where fast turns and dynamic motion create an adrenaline filled experience. For those who prefer a slower pace, the vintage car rides offer a nostalgic journey through beautifully landscaped surroundings. Every attraction is thoughtfully designed, ensuring that both thrill and comfort are perfectly balanced.

For visitors looking to explore something mysterious, the haunted house provides an engaging and slightly eerie adventure. With immersive storytelling and creative design, it adds a touch of suspense to the overall experience. This variety of attractions makes Tivoli Gardens more than just an amusement park it becomes a place where imagination comes alive.

Beyond the rides, Tivoli offers unique experiences such as its fascinating aquarium featuring a 30 meter coral reef tank. As you stroll alongside this stunning display, you can marvel at sharks and vibrant marine life, creating a peaceful contrast to the excitement of the rides. This combination of thrill and tranquility makes the park truly special.
